Club Car 2007 Precedent - testing OBC or resetting
We have four Club Car 2007 Precedents and we are not sure if the obc's in any of the cars are still operative - these car are infrequently used. Is there a simple way to test whether the OBC's are operative because, at the moment they do not let the Powerdrive charger recharge the batteries? It seems strange that all four obc's should fail at the same time - we have followed instructions from other posts to reboot or reset the OBC's - but without success. We have even replaced the four Trojan batteries in each car - still no recharge happening.
So can we somehow test if the obc's need replacing - pretty expensive thing to do if they are not the problem! Thank you |

Re: Club Car 2007 Precedent - testing OBC or resetting
. . . I assume you checked out all applicable fuses in the cart . . . open up one of your chargers and jumper out the relay as noted in below picture . . . if charger turns on normally when you plug it into cart, it indicates a problem with the OBC/charge circuit in the cart . . . do not leave this relay jumpered out because charger will not turn off automatically because you are bypassing the OBC . . .
